Web3风格UI设计:定义、趋势与最佳实践

随着区块链技术的迅猛发展,Web3的概念逐渐成型,并成为科技界的热门话题。Web3代表着去中心化的互联网生态系统,与传统的Web2(集中式互联网)相对比,它通过区块链技术实现了用户与服务提供者之间的直接连接。在这一背景下,Web3风格的用户界面(UI)设计越来越受到开发者和设计师的重视。那么,什么是Web3风格的UI设计?它有什么独特之处?在这篇文章中,我们将对Web3风格的UI设计进行详细探讨,涵盖其定义、趋势和最佳实践。

何为Web3风格的UI设计

Web3风格的UI设计是建立在去中心化理念之上的用户界面设计,它旨在为用户提供更安全、更个性化的体验。这种设计风格通常会围绕区块链技术,强调用户的自主权和隐私保护。在Web3环境中,用户的数据不再由中心化的服务器控制,而是分散存储在区块链之上,因此,UI设计必须考虑到这一点,保护用户信息,并向用户提供清晰的操作反馈。

在Web3风格的UI设计中,用户体验(UX)尤为重要。设计师需要创造易于理解和使用的界面,以便用户能够顺利地与去中心化应用(dApps)进行交互。此外,Web3 UI设计往往会融入区块链特有的元素,如钱包连接、代币交易、合约签署等,这些组件的展示和交互设计需要显得直观而有利于用户操作。

Web3风格UI设计的趋势

随着Web3的发展,UI设计也在不断演化。在这一过程中,几个趋势逐渐显现,其中包括:

1. **简约设计**:Web3 UI设计日益趋向简约,去繁从简,专注于核心功能。用户在使用去中心化应用时,往往不希望被杂乱的设计元素所困扰。因此,设计者越来越倾向于使用干净的布局、简单的配色和直观的导航。

2. **互动性和动画效果**:为了提升用户体验,许多Web3应用开始融入更多的互动性元素和动画效果。这些特性不仅能够吸引用户,还能提供更加流畅的交互,使用户在与区块链进行交易时,能够获得更好的实时反馈。

3. **用户教育**:鉴于Web3技术的复杂性,越来越多的设计师开始在UI中融入教育性元素。这些元素可以是工具提示、使用教程或是FAQ,以帮助用户更好地理解如何使用去中心化应用,提升用户的使用意愿。

4. **无缝集成的钱包功能**:由于去中心化应用需要与用户的加密钱包进行交互,优质的Web3 UI设计将更加关注钱包集成的便利性。设计师需要确保用户能够轻松连接、切换和管理他们的钱包,从而不影响使用体验。

Web3 UI设计的最佳实践

为了打造优秀的Web3风格UI,设计师可以遵循以下最佳实践:

1. **用户中心设计**:Web3应用的设计应该以用户为中心,深入了解目标用户的需求和痛点。通过用户测试和反馈,调整设计以满足用户的直观需求。

2. **透明性**:透明性是去中心化的核心价值之一。在UI设计中,设计师要确保用户能够明确理解他们的数据如何被使用,交易的具体细节,以及他们在该平台的权限。

3. **可访问性**:确保你的Web3应用能够被所有用户访问,包括有不同能力的用户。遵循可访问性标准(例如WCAG)能够让更多的人群享受应用带来的价值。

4. **性能**:在Web3环境中,用户操作的效率至关重要。设计师需要界面的性能,确保每个组件的加载速度和响应时间都能够满足用户的期望。

与Web3风格UI设计相关的常见问题

1. Web3 UI设计与传统UI设计有什么区别?

Web3 UI设计与传统UI设计之间存在多方面的区别,其中最显著的就是数据管理方式的不同。在传统的Web2环境中,用户数据通常集中存储于中央服务器,设计师在构建UI时主要关注如何使数据呈现得更加美观和易于操作。而在Web3环境下,数据则分散存储在多个节点上,涉及到区块链技术,这使得设计师在设计 UI 时需更关注用户隐私、数据保护和去中心化的理念。

此外,Web3 UI设计必须集成复杂的区块链元素,例如加密钱包、代币交易等。在这类设计中,用户体验的流畅性和直观性变得更加重要,设计师需要考虑用户如何与这些元素互动,而不是仅仅专注于视觉美感。

再者,Web3 UI设计需要教育用户,使他们理解去中心化应用的操作流程。这通常包括提供详细的使用指南、交互式提示或是FAQ,以帮助用户更顺畅地使用应用,而传统UI设计往往更依赖于在线帮助文档或工具提示。

2. 如何使Web3 UI设计保持用户参与感?

在Web3环境中保持用户参与感是设计的一大挑战,尤其是面对一些技术门槛较高的用户。为了提高用户参与度,设计师可以考虑以下几个方面:

首先,强化社会互动是增加用户参与感的重要策略。Web3应用可以允许用户在平台内进行互动,例如评论、点赞或分享他们的活动和成就。社交元素能够提高用户的归属感,从而促进留存率。

其次,利用游戏化元素也是拉动用户参与感的行之有效的方法。通过设置奖励机制或成就系统,激励用户积极参与到应用的各项活动中。例如,用户在进行某项交易或完成特定任务后,可以获得代币奖励或经验值,从而促进用户持续使用。

此外,UI设计还应考虑到个性化体验为用户提供的吸引力。例如,通过根据用户的行为和偏好,提供量身定制的信息和推荐,能够让用户感受到被重视,进而提高用户的活跃度。

3. UI设计如何确保Web3应用的安全性?

在Web3生态中,用户安全是设计中的核心考虑因素之一。由于区块链技术的敏感性,设计师必须仔细考虑自用户界面的每个方面,以确保安全性。以下是一些最佳实践:

首先,设计师应该明确提示用户在使用去中心化应用时需要负的责任。例如,在用户进行交易之前,可以设置多种确认步骤,确保用户真正愿意执行该操作。此外,设计中可以采用警示图标,提示用户注意潜在的风险。

其次,提供多种安全验证方式,如双重身份验证(2FA),可以显著提高用户账户的安全性。在设计UI过程中,确保这些安全方式的易用性,可以有效降低因忘记密码或因账户被盗引发的安全问题。

此外,对敏感信息的保护同样至关重要,设计师应该尽量减少在界面上显示用户的敏感数据。在必要时,可以设计模糊的方式呈现这些信息,例如通过显示部分字符或使用加密技术保护数据。

4. 在Web3环境中,如何选择合适的设计工具?

选择合适的设计工具是实现优质Web3 UI设计的关键,然而,设计工具的选择要考虑多个方面,包括团队需求、项目复杂性以及设计阶段等。

1. **功能全面性**:对于Web3 UI设计,工具需要支持高保真原型制作、互动设计以及协作功能。一些知名的设计工具,如Figma和Adobe XD,因其强大的功能和易用性而被广泛采用。

2. **支持开放标准**:Web3强调去中心化和开放性,设计工具如果能支持开放标准(如SVG或Markdown),将使得设计能够更灵活地应用在不同的开发环境中。

3. **团队协作能力**:在Web3项目中,团队成员往往需要实时协作和反馈,因此选择具有实时协作能力的设计工具显得尤其重要。像Figma这样的工具能够让多个设计师和开发者同时在一个项目上进行工作,提高了工作效率。

4. **易学习性**:有时,团队中可能会有一些新手加入,为了使团队能够迅速上手,选择易于学习的工具将极大地帮助团队的新成员。Figma和Sketch等工具都因其直观的界面和强大的社区支持而受到追捧。

总的来说,随著Web3风格的UI设计发展,设计实践也在不断创新。设计师们需要结合去中心化的理念,在用户体验与安全性之间找到平衡,以创造出符合用户期待的优秀产品。希望通过这篇文章,大家对Web3 UI设计有一个更深入的了解,能够在实践中不断提升自己的设计能力。